Difference between Weather and Climate
- Weather is the state of the atmosphere over an area at any point of time while climate is the sum total of weather conditions and variations over a large area for a long period of time.
- Weather conditions change frequently whereas climate does not change so frequently, it remains same year after year.
- Weather data are recorded at a specific time while climate is recorded for a longer period of time.
- Example of weather: dry weather, windy weather, etc. Example of climate: tropical monsoon climate, equatorial climate, etc.
